Philip "Phil" Theriault DEXTER- Phil Theriault, 82, died peacefully August 15, 2023 at his Maple Street home after a short but courageous battle with cancer. Phil was born July 2, 1941 in Madawaska, as Harold Louis Philippe Theriault to Valier and Jeanne (Albert) Theriault, grew up in Pittsfield, and graduated from Maine Central Institute, Class of 1959. He met his love, Carolyn and married on June 17, 1961 and shared 54 wonderful years of marriage and adventures. Phil was a hard worker and owned Philroy Construction until his retirement. He later started Gray Barn Antiques with Carolyn, which took them to Florida and around New England for many years, always returning with hilarious stories. Phil was many things to many people; loving husband, wonderful father, dedicated "Papa" and was happy to know that in January 2024 would have been a great grandfather to two new Theriaults. Many called him a friend. He was a mentor to many young men over the years. He was a talented artist and a problem solver, but mostly he was a fun-loving man that was always ready for a fishing trip, hunting trip, social gathering and proud fan at his children's and grandchildren's many events. Phil and Carolyn suffered the tragic loss of their only son, Christopher on March 27, 1986. Phil lost his Carolyn on July 7, 2015. He was also predeceased by his parents, many close friends and his son in law, David York. He is survived by his daughters, Debbie York of Dexter and Susan and son in law Jeff Warren of Oakland. "Papa" is also survived by five grandchildren: Dylan Tibbetts (Samantha) of Gardiner, Quinn Warren (Katie) of Oakland, Dalton Tibbetts of Pittston, Parker Tibbetts (Reghan) of Harmony and Emmy Warren (Sawyer) of Sanford; two sisters, Rena Hodgins (Roydan) of Detroit and Sharon (Patrick) Lee of Yarmouth. Phil is also survived by his companion, Lillie Ambrose of Dexter who took loving care of him. Phil was a communicant of St. Anne's Catholic Church and a Knight of Columbus.
